how many moles are in 7.1x10^21 atoms of iron?

Respuesta :

Medunno13
Medunno13 Medunno13
  • 01-03-2022

Answer:

0.011 moles

Explanation:

There are about 6.02*10^23 atoms in a mole, so in the given sample, there are

[tex] \frac{7.01 \times {10}^{21} }{6.02 \times {10}^{23} } [/tex]

which is about 0.011 moles.
